13/02/2020 16:05

Repairs to the wet abutments of Bridge 102 have been delayed due to additional works being required to address a bulge in the offside abutment. 

Our contractors are working hard to minimise the impact on the duration of the closure but we will need to extend the stoppage for up to one week in order to complete the extra work involved.

Description

The wet abutments of the bridge are in a poor state of repair. Fabric dams are required to dewater this section so that the underwater repairs to the bridge can take place.
